In this article, you can see that japanese eggs are very safe compared to those from other countries. The real reason raw eggs are generally safe to eat in japan. Eggs raised and produced in japan are safe to eat raw. Vaccinated hens, rigorous sanitation, and advanced egg inspections minimize salmonella risk, making them generally safe for dishes.
